1

Я пытаюсь загрузить фотографию из Интернета, но всегда возникает ошибка. Я попытался запустить команду в пакетной программе ".cmd" со следующими кодами: wget http://weather.is.kochi-u.ac.jp/SE/00Latest.jpg

но я всегда получаю сообщение об ошибке: Подключение к weather.is.kochi-u.ac.jp:80 ... подключиться: нет такого файла или каталога

Я пробовал несколько вариантов, таких как --user --user-agent --proxy --tries, но не работает.

Я работаю из своего офиса, и у нас есть прокси-сервер для доступа в Интернет. Я не уверен, влияет ли это на мою команду с помощью wget.

У меня есть команда, использующая powershell -Command, и она отлично работает, но не может работать под планировщиком задач, поэтому я решил использовать wget, как это большинство рекомендовало. Тем не менее, я не мог заставить его работать, когда тестировал его.

Кто-нибудь здесь может указать мне правильное направление? Я не программист или кто-то с большими знаниями в этой области, но я достаточно осведомлен, чтобы учиться и понимать. ТИА.

2 ответа2

0

Работал нормально для меня.

C:\> wget.exe http://weather.is.kochi-u.ac.jp/SE/00Latest.jpg
- 22: 41: 31 - http://weather.is.kochi-u.ac.jp/SE/00Latest.jpg
=> '00Latest.jpg'
Разрешение weather.is.kochi-u.ac.jp ... сделано.
Подключение к weather.is.kochi-u.ac.jp [133.97.166.237]: 80 ... подключено.
HTTP-запрос отправлен в ожидании ответа ... 200 ОК
Длина: 58,534 [изображение / JPEG]

100% [===========================================>] 58 534 52,59 К / с ETA 00:00

22:41:32 (52,59 КБ / с) - `00Latest.jpg 'сохранено [58534/58534]


C:\>

(Некоторые небольшие изменения ... Я преобразовал одну обратную кавычку в апостраф, и вкладки отображаются не совсем правильно ... Моя основная идея показать некоторые примеры вывода - он работал нормально.)

Если это не работает для вас, я думаю, что это проблема с подключением к Интернету. Возможно, у вас есть блокировщик контента, который запрещает HTTP-соединение. Возможно, необходимо использовать HTTP-прокси. Тем не менее, команда wget работает нормально. Итак, из моего теста я бы сказал, что вам нужно попробовать исправить не ваш основной синтаксис wget. Если вам нужно изменить синтаксис, как, например, ссылка на веб-прокси, вам может потребоваться определить настройки другим способом (устранение неполадок в другом случае). Можете ли вы посетить файл jpg в любом другом программном обеспечении для захвата веб-страниц?

Если вы не доверяете правильности работы wget, существует множество вариантов wget, а также других программ, таких как curl, которые можно попробовать. Вероятно, они будут действовать так же, но если они этого не сделают, то, очевидно, у вас будет свой ответ.

0

Правильный синтаксис с прокси-сервером:

C:\> wget -e http_proxy=127.0.0.1:3128 www.example.com

IP/ порт зависит, конечно же, от прокси вашего офиса.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.